#53c748 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#53c748 is composed of 32.5% red, 78%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.8% yellow and 22% black. It has a hue angle of 114.8 degrees, a saturation of 53.1% and a lightness of 53.1%. #53c748 color hex could be obtained by blending #a6ff90 with #008f00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c33.

Shades and Tints of #53c748

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040c04 is the darkest color, while #fcfef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#53c748

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#81907f is the less saturated color, while #25fe11 is the most saturated one.
